EWR Airport is the abbreviation for Newark Liberty International Airport, a major aviation hub located in Newark, New Jersey.

This airport serves as one of the busiest gateways to the New York metropolitan area and plays a vital role in global air travel.     The History of EWR Airport

    EWR Airport has a rich history that dates back to its establishment in 1928. Originally named Newark Metropolitan Airport, it became the first major airport in the United States when it opened. Over the decades, it underwent several name changes, eventually becoming Newark Liberty International Airport in 2001 to honor the victims of the September 11 attacks.

    Where is EWR Airport Located?

    EWR Airport is situated in Newark, New Jersey, approximately 15 miles from New York City. Its strategic location makes it an ideal starting point for travelers visiting both New Jersey and the bustling metropolis of New York. The airport's proximity to major highways and public transportation networks ensures convenient access for passengers.

    Transportation to and from EWR Airport

    Getting to and from EWR Airport is made easy with a variety of transportation options. Whether you prefer public transit, taxis, ride-sharing services, or car rentals, the airport provides convenient access to all these choices.

    Popular Transportation Methods

    • Newark Airport Rail Link: Connects the airport to Penn Station in Midtown Manhattan.
    • Taxis and Ride-Sharing: Available 24/7 for direct travel to your destination.
    • Car Rentals: Numerous rental agencies are located on-site for added convenience.

    With these options, travelers can choose the method that best suits their schedule and budget, ensuring a stress-free journey to and from EWR Airport.
